I have a garage of Porter Cable tools... saws, drills and both 7424 models... I have had my original 7424 for about 4 or 5 years now... no problems. Just needed to replace the brushes. I have had the XP for almost 2 years... no problems. I do not run a high volume operation, but it's fair to say I have put both machines through their paces. Mr. Theal runs a pretty high volume operation, and the 7424 isn't exactly a heavy duty machine intended for production type work. I would expect a unit to wear more quickly under those circumstances.
